WebHumus accumulation and decomposition are in equilibrium. In the long term, humus reserves result from a balance between the decomposition of humus by soil organisms and the build-up of humus fed by crop residues such as straw and roots as well as organic fertilisers. If this balance shifts, the humus reserves change. WebHumus contains numerous minerals and nutrients, and is around 60% carbon, which is essential for healthy soil quality.
